This critical reflection will consider how our current lifestyles and the unsustainability of our consumer habits, and the energies required to power new technologies, are the biggest ignored threates to the environment and the continuation of the Earth. It will do so by examining the overwhelming rate at which new technologies are upgraded which consequently not only creates physical waste, but also mandates enormous energies to power them. By identifying why we consume and waste at our current rate, this reflection critically examines the impact our practices have on nature, wildlife and climate change and also the reason why we are doing very little to tackle it.
